Great Smoky Mountain Trail Ride 07

Registration is open for GSMTR 07 to be held 14-19 May 2007 . We have rented Crawford's campground, the finest 4x4 campground in the country for the event. We are again offering an optional White Water rafting trip on Wednesday. Thursday evening the FJ Cruiser Trail Team will cook for us followed by a Blue Grass band and Adult refreshments . Friday night we will have BBQ and fresh fried Catfish followed by the an awesome raffle and awards ceremony.

Sorry folks we are old school, no online registration and we don't take paypal or credit cards, fill out the form, write a check and mail it to us.
If you don't want to rip the registration form out of your T/T you can down load one at stlca.org

Hope to see you all there.

They have closed camping in the OHV area along trail 1 and 5 ( this includes the area at rough water). The Tennessee side has been redone, nicer spaces, better out houses but less of them. Also they have perodically been inforcing the the no alcohol in the campground rules including cooler checks. If you want to safely drink in camp you need to camp on North River and the drive from there is aslong as it is from Crawford's and they are primitive sites.
